Why is my QuickBooks Not Loading?

Check the causes below that are preventing your QuickBooks from loading properly.

  • Browser cache: Browser cache and corrupted data can stop QuickBooks from loading.
  • Windows operating system: Sometimes your windows settings or outdated windows can also create an issue.
  • Due to exceed compony file character: If your company file name exceed the limit then you can face loading issues.
  • Expire QuickBooks version: Outdated QuickBooks software can also create issue.
  • Bad installation of application: If the QuickBooks is not installed properly then you can face issues.

Fix Quickbooks Online Not Loading

If your QuickBooks is not loading properly on the browser, then you can clear the cache of the browser by following the steps below.

In chrome browser

  1. Click on three dots from the top right side of your screen.
  2. Click on more tools option.
  3. Clear browsing data.
  4. Choose range from top right select all time and delete everything.
  5. Check the boxes “cookies and other site data” and “cached images and files”.
  6. Click on clear data.

In Mozilla Firefox browser

  1. Click on the hamburger menu at top right corner and select settings.
  2. Select privacy and security by left navigation panel.
  3. Scroll down and select cookies and site data and click on clear data.Check the box cookies and site data and click on clear.

Change special character from company file name

QuickBooks allowed only some special characters in company file name. If you are facing loading issue while opening QuickBooks then you can try removing special character from company file name for fixing the issue. To make changes to the company file name follow the steps below.

  1. Open QuickBooks on your web browser.
  2. Choose Account settings.
  3. Select gear icon from the settings.
  4. On left panel select compony.
  5. Click on edit icon from the company name category.
  6. Change the invalid special character.
  7. Click on save and then Done to confirm.

On QuickBooks Desktop App

  1. On your keyboard press f2 or ctrl+1 to get product information.
  2. Note the location of the file.
  3. Right-click on the windows icon click and open file explorer.
  4. Go to the file location.
  5. Right-click on the file name and click on rename.
  6. Now remove any unnecessary character and save it.

After changing the company file name, reboot your desktop and check if the QuickBooks not loading issue is resolved or not.

Enable third-party cookies on Browser

Some websites require third-party cookies enabled in the browser settings to function properly. If the third-party cookies are disabled on your browser then QuickBooks online can stop loading properly on your browser. You can try enabling the browser cache by following the steps below.

  1. On google chrome click on three dots at the top right corner.
  2. Click on settings and scroll to select privacy and security.
  3. Click on site setting and then cookies and site data.
  4. Go to the privacy and security section and select content settings.
  5. Click on allow sites to save and read cookies data.

After enabling cookies check if the QuickBooks is loading or not.

Download QuickBooks tool Hub

QuickBooks tool hub can help you in fixing issues related to QuickBooks program on your desktop. You can follow the steps below to download the tool hub and troubleshoot QuickBooks not loading on your pc.

  1. On your web browser visit QuickBookstoolhub.com and download.
  2. When downloads are complete open QuickBookstoolhub.exe file.
  3. Install it by following the on-screen process. Don’t do anything while the program running and when completed QuickBooks should load now.

Now run quick fix my program

  1. Open QuickBooks tool hub.
  2. Select fix my program.
  3. Once the process is complete, now check if the issue is resolved or not.

Run QuickBooks Install Diagnostics in QuickBooks Tool Hub

If the QuickBooks is not properly installed or if some files are damaged or missing, then you can face QuickBooks not loading issue. In this scenario, you can run the installation diagnostics in the tool hub by following the steps below.

  1. Open QuickBooks tool hub.
  2. Now click on QuickBooks install diagnostics tool. 
  3. It will take 20 minutes.
  4. Restart your pc. 

Now check if the QuickBooks is loading or not.

QuickBooks Online is Opened on More Than One PC

Your QuickBooks online will not load properly if you are trying to open QuickBooks online on too many desktops. In this scenario close the QuickBooks on another system, then try opening the QuickBooks on one pc. Now, your QuickBooks online will load on your desktop browser without any issues.

Reinstall QuickBooks on Your Desktop

Uninstall QuickBooks

  1. Press Windows icon now search and open the control panel.
  2. Now select uninstall a program.
  3. Locate and right-click on QuickBooks.
  4. Now click on uninstall.

Install QuickBooks

  1. Download QuickBooks on your pc.
  2. Double click on QuickBooks.exe for installation.
  3. Now follow the on-screen instruction to install QuickBooks on your desktop.

Now you’ll be able to QuickBooks on your desktop without any loading issues.
